Specification | HTC One A9s | Xiaomi Redmi Note 4 (3GB RAM+32GB) |
---|---|---|
CPU | 1.8 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 2 GHz, Octa Core Processor |
Display | 5 inches, 720 x 1280 pixels | 5.5 inches, 1920 x 1080 pixels |
Rear Camera | 13 MP with autofocus | 13 MP |
Battery | 2300 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 4100 mAh |
OS | Android v6.0 (Marshmallow) | Android v6.0.1 (Marshmallow), upgradable to v7.0 (Nougat) |
Price | ₹19,999 | ₹7,799 |
